As authorities continue investigating the death of actor Stewart McLean, family members and colleagues are sharing heartfelt memories of the beloved Canadian performer.

McLean, who appeared in series including Virgin River, Arrow, and Loudermilk, was found dead in British Columbia after being reported missing for approximately one week. Police later confirmed the case was being treated as a homicide investigation.

In emotional social media tributes, longtime friends described McLean as thoughtful, talented, and deeply respected throughout the entertainment industry.

Acting coach Jeff Seymour remembered driving through Los Angeles with McLean while the actor sang along to classic songs from the 1960s and 1970s. “You will be greatly missed, my friend,” Seymour wrote.

Filmmaker Ryan Minaker praised McLean’s dedication and professionalism, calling him “an inspiration” whose contagious laugh left a lasting impact on everyone around him.

McLean’s family also issued a statement honoring their “dear younger brother,” describing him as caring, genuine, and funny.

Authorities say the homicide investigation remains ongoing.
